Board Briefing — Pilot Churn (Fernhollow Analytics)

Quick update: the Meridia pilot lost 7 of 40 accounts last quarter, mostly smaller firms citing onboarding friction. The fix — a guided setup flow — ships next month. Retention among larger pilot accounts remains strong at 94%. We're not panicking, but we are watching closely. The confidential note below sets out our intended response.

board note of bawep-tajef: Queniusek Systems plans to raise the Quenvan list price by 53.1 percent in March. The pricing group signed off on a budget of $176.4 million for Project Drueth. The renewal with Casionix Partners closes at $142.5 million a year, 8.3 percent below the last contract. Project Fraax slips by six weeks because of the tooling delay.

// HookRelay delivery client.
// Welcome aboard. Retry semantics: deliveries retry with exponential
// backoff (1s base, 6 attempts max). A 2xx ends the cycle; 410 drops
// the endpoint permanently; everything else requeues. Duplicate
// deliveries are possible — consumers must be idempotent on the
// event ID header. Never retry manually from this client; let the
// scheduler own it. The client authenticates to the internal relay
// with the key that appears directly below.

app token of kagap-fahag = zpat2_0m

**Vendor note: Fernlock DocLint**

Our contract with Hollowpine Systems for the Fernlock documentation linter renews next quarter. Usage is up 40% since the style-rule rollout, so we should confirm seat counts before renewal and request updated pricing tiers. Hollowpine has offered a pilot of their new API-reference checker. Please review the terms before the sync; renewal questions go to their account desk at the address below.

alerts address for kajog-tadup: druox@plorvanet.internal